Hello guys

Decided to start this thread as I want to keep track of changes I've done to the car.
I'm a second owner of a 2015 WRX STI GT edition with a totally useless options such as sun roof, navigation, Harman Kardon stereo and some other minor things I can't remember right now. Somehow I always thought that Harman Kardon is a decent company and they are not selling their logo to the car audio manufacturers. Tried to listen Gregory Porter's CD the first day I received a car and after 3 minutes turned it off forever.



First thing installed were an OEM wind visors or deflectors and a JDM rear aero splash guards:


The main reason I bought a GT edition is an absence of a big wing which imho doesn't look good on a VA body. I went with a OEM WRX spoiler.


And an OEM STI lip.



Bought an OEM WRX S4 fog light bezels with LED DRLs and waiting for them to arrive.


Next thing on a list is a WRX S4 OEM LED fog lights.


Oh nearly forgot one thing. Fender emblems from PRC are waiting for warmer weather to be installed.
